背景Timsort 是一个混合、稳定的排序算法,简单来说就是归并排序和二分插入排序算法的混合体,号称世界上最好的排序算法。Timsort一直是 Pyt...
算法要求输入:一个最多包含n个正整数的文件,其中每个数字都小于n(n=10^7)没有重复文件输出:按照升序输出约束条件:只有1M左右的内存空间,足够的...
先看下图:真是厉害啊,这排序, 既有多线程,又有排序,还有lambda表达式,但是这是C#版本,作为一个入坑的Java爱好者,当然要去试试Java版本...
冒泡排序介绍冒泡排序(Bubble Sort),又被称为气泡排序或泡沫排序。它是一种较简单的排序算法。它会遍历若干次要排序的数列,每次遍历时,它都会从...
Java是一门面向对象编程语言,是一种广泛使用的计算机编程语言,拥有跨平台、面向对象、泛型编程的特性,广泛应用于企业级Web应用开发和移动应用开发。算...
插入排序,这种排序在平时生活中很常见,打扑克时拿到凌乱的手牌捋顺序,整理手上大大小小的钞票等等。 ...